1. Haier HCE519F
This sturdy chest freezer will last for a long time if you are willing to pay for a little more. Its capacity of 252 litres is enough to hold more than 10 shopping bags and is ideal for large families. It's made to be used in garages as well as outbuildings that aren't heated as well, and also uses low frost technology for easy maintenance, so it requires defrosting once every few years.
The lid is counterbalanced so it is easy to sift your items and not have to be concerned about the lid hitting you in the head. This is especially useful when you're trying to retrieve frozen fish fingers that have been forgotten. You'll find a wire storage basket which clips to the rim for smaller items as well as a built-in interior light to aid you in separating items easily.
The freezer's energy use is rated A in the new energy efficiency scale which makes it a great option to reduce your electricity bills. It will keep your food safe for up to 24 hours in the case of a power interruption, which gives you peace of mind.

4. Bush BECF99L
This Bush chest freezer is ideal in the event that you're looking to add storage space at a reasonable price. It's a great size to fit in a corner of your house and can be used in areas that aren't heated, such as garages or outbuildings. It has a lid that is balanced so it doesn't shut on your head while you're retrieving food and is almost silent, meaning that you will not be disturbed while at home. It doesn't include an electronic display, temperature website warnings or more than one storage basket.
The chest freezer has an impressive capacity of 139 litres, which is enough to hold 10 shopping bags for the majority of households. It is also compact and quiet, so it won't take up too much space in your kitchen. It is also good for the environment and has an A+ rating.
